Why Flat Burr Grinders Matter

Flat burr grinders represent the gold standard for consistency. The flat burr design creates superior particle uniformity.

Superior Consistency

Flat burrs produce more uniform particle size distribution, resulting in more even extraction.

Better Espresso Performance

The parallel burr design creates better pressure distribution and more balanced shots.

Cooler Grinding

Flat burrs generate less heat during grinding, preserving flavor compounds.

Longer Burr Life

Quality flat burrs maintain sharpness longer than conical burrs.

Cleaner Cup Profile

Uniform grind size means fewer fines and boulders, resulting in cleaner flavor.
